Transaction 78cc21e95b961936e3d036c7459a7d56121a15ff882c5d0b8804776f57f62c5d
1 Input
2 Outputs
- 78cc21e95b961936e3d036c7459a7d56121a15ff882c5d0b8804776f57f62c5d:0
- 78cc21e95b961936e3d036c7459a7d56121a15ff882c5d0b8804776f57f62c5d:1
value 31082039
address 1BDNPeQCokJjtQ4SHEh9QJJzQJpZ2cpP6U
value 23912844
address 1E5Rz1TjefGifgaaMPACbnBKnCFd2dFxYY